A meta-analysis by the Institute of Transport Economics in Norway found that red-light cameras (RLCs) lead to an overall increase in accidents of about 15%. Rear-end collisions went up by about 40%, right angle collisions down by about 10%. It concludes: "RLCs may reduce crashes under some conditions, but on the whole they do not seem to be a successful safety measure."
